Question online radiator place

I need to replace my radiator and was wondering what the name of the place a few members bought there rads from. I know it was mentioned a while back that some guy on ebay had them, and they seemed to work out great. I couldn't find the listing.

Oh, do these radiators have the turned up lower outlet?

Any board vendors selling radiators? If so, please let me know because I would rather order from one of you guys.

It's funny you ask. I just bought a radiator from 1-800-Radiators through Ebay. $133 for a 4 row. It has the turned up lower hose fitting too. $158 delivered. You know it was amazing. I bid on the thing and won it. I called them up with the auction number at like 7pm on Friday night. They took my credit card and said it could show up tomorrow or by the end of the week, did I want express delivery? I said nope.. just the normal shipping is fine. At 11:30am on Saturday I got a call on my cell from a nice lady saying she was at my door trying to deliver my radiator. It blew me away. She left it on the door step for me. Great quality.
